[Canada, Australia, New Zealand]
Canada has LM Montgomery's Anne of Green Gables (1908), but its forte is in animal stories pioneered by ET Seton and GD Roberts from the end of the 19th century, and this tradition lives on in F. Mowat's My Pet Owl (1961) and S. Bunford's The Incredible Journey (1977). The recent rise of Australian children's literature has been remarkable.
